Transaction 2ab81ae39e4af22d9370636f0329d97ce295b86636915c51c8bfc932cb9393e5

1 Input
2 Outputs
  • 2ab81ae39e4af22d9370636f0329d97ce295b86636915c51c8bfc932cb9393e5:0
  • value  103805
    address  19GPunpYAeL2WudXwobsCNApGLTMjcuiwh
  • 2ab81ae39e4af22d9370636f0329d97ce295b86636915c51c8bfc932cb9393e5:1
  • value  2723867
    address  3GYxZ6pKi2mc3sYd28Cuz22Cv5NKNGJgBR